Mercurial > repos > artbio > bamparse
comparison bamparse.xml @ 3:120eb76aa500 draft
planemo upload for repository https://github.com/ARTbio/tools-artbio/tree/master/tools/bamparse commit e8a19ac6ada887e6daa0a2e2abc9ba69392cdb8a
author | artbio |
---|---|
date | Mon, 17 Jul 2023 01:02:17 +0000 |
parents | 8ea06787c08a |
children | 1997af8f4648 |
comparison
equal
deleted
inserted
replaced
2:8ea06787c08a | 3:120eb76aa500 |
---|---|
1 <tool id="bamparse" name="Count alignments" version="3.0.0"> | 1 <tool id="bamparse" name="Count alignments" version="4.0.0"> |
2 <description>in a BAM file</description> | 2 <description>in a BAM file</description> |
3 <requirements> | 3 <requirements> |
4 <requirement type="package" version="0.11.2.1">pysam</requirement> | 4 <requirement type="package" version="0.21.0=py310h41dec4a_1">pysam</requirement> |
5 <requirement type="package" version="0.6.6">sambamba</requirement> | 5 <requirement type="package" version="1.0=h98b6b92_0">sambamba</requirement> |
6 <requirement type="package" version="1.17=hd87286a_1">samtools</requirement> | |
6 </requirements> | 7 </requirements> |
7 <stdio> | 8 <stdio> |
8 <exit_code range="1:" level="fatal" description="Tool exception" /> | 9 <exit_code range="1:" level="fatal" description="Tool exception" /> |
9 </stdio> | 10 </stdio> |
10 <command detect_errors="exit_code"><![CDATA[ | 11 <command detect_errors="exit_code"><![CDATA[ |
53 <tests> | 54 <tests> |
54 <test> | 55 <test> |
55 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> | 56 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> |
56 <param name="polarity" value="both" /> | 57 <param name="polarity" value="both" /> |
57 <param name="output_option" value="unique" /> | 58 <param name="output_option" value="unique" /> |
58 <output name="output" ftype="tabular" file="table.tabular" /> | 59 <output name="output" ftype="tabular" file="table.tabular" count="1"/> |
59 </test> | 60 </test> |
60 <test> | 61 <test> |
61 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> | 62 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> |
62 <param name="polarity" value="both" /> | 63 <param name="polarity" value="both" /> |
63 <param name="output_option" value="multiple" /> | 64 <param name="output_option" value="multiple" /> |
67 </test> | 68 </test> |
68 <test> | 69 <test> |
69 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> | 70 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> |
70 <param name="polarity" value="sense" /> | 71 <param name="polarity" value="sense" /> |
71 <param name="output_option" value="unique" /> | 72 <param name="output_option" value="unique" /> |
72 <output name="output" ftype="tabular" file="table.tabular" /> | 73 <output name="output" ftype="tabular" file="table.tabular" count="1"/> |
73 </test> | 74 </test> |
74 <test> | 75 <test> |
75 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> | 76 <param name="input_list" value="alignment1.bam,alignment2.bam" ftype="bam" /> |
76 <param name="polarity" value="antisense" /> | 77 <param name="polarity" value="antisense" /> |
77 <param name="output_option" value="unique" /> | 78 <param name="output_option" value="unique" /> |
78 <output name="output" ftype="tabular" file="table_antisense.tabular" /> | 79 <output name="output" ftype="tabular" file="table_antisense.tabular" count="1"/> |
79 </test> | 80 </test> |
80 | 81 |
81 <test> | 82 <test> |
82 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> | 83 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> |
83 <param name="polarity" value="both" /> | 84 <param name="polarity" value="both" /> |
89 </test> | 90 </test> |
90 <test> | 91 <test> |
91 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> | 92 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> |
92 <param name="polarity" value="sense" /> | 93 <param name="polarity" value="sense" /> |
93 <param name="output_option" value="unique" /> | 94 <param name="output_option" value="unique" /> |
94 <output name="output" ftype="tabular" file="more_sense_table.tabular" /> | 95 <output name="output" ftype="tabular" file="more_sense_table.tabular" count="1"/> |
95 </test> | 96 </test> |
96 <test> | 97 <test> |
97 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> | 98 <param name="input_list" value="input1.bam,input2.bam,input_new2.bam" ftype="bam" /> |
98 <param name="polarity" value="antisense" /> | 99 <param name="polarity" value="antisense" /> |
99 <param name="output_option" value="unique" /> | 100 <param name="output_option" value="unique" /> |
100 <output name="output" ftype="tabular" file="more_antisense_table.tabular" /> | 101 <output name="output" ftype="tabular" file="more_antisense_table.tabular" count="1"/> |
101 </test> | 102 </test> |
102 | 103 |
103 | 104 |
104 </tests> | 105 </tests> |
105 <help> | 106 <help> |